In this review of Thorvin Icelandic kelp for animals the bottom line is simple: this 100% organic kelp is best for owners who want a daily, natural mineral boost to support skin, coat, digestion and thyroid-related needs across multiple species. Our review finds it most valuable because it supplies an unusually broad spectrum of trace minerals and amino acids in a dry, easy-to-mix form that works with raw, dehydrated, frozen, or dried rations. It is intended for dogs, cats, horses, goats, chickens and other livestock, and should not be fed to rabbits.

Who It's For
This supplement is for owners seeking a natural, multi-species kelp powder to add trace minerals and vitamins to pet or farm animal diets. It is particularly useful for animals with dull coats, mild skin irritation, or those on home-prepared diets that may lack naturally occurring marine minerals.
Those who should look elsewhere include rabbit owners, because the iodine content makes it unsuitable for rabbits, and people needing a precision veterinary treatment for severe thyroid disease or acute nutritional deficiencies - in such cases consult a veterinarian first.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I feed this to rabbits?
No. Do not feed to rabbits because the iodine content can be harmful to them.
How should I store the kelp?
Store in a cool, dry place to preserve freshness and nutrient quality.
Is this safe for senior pets?
Yes, it is indicated as suitable for all life stages and can be used as a senior pet supplement, but consult a veterinarian for pets with thyroid conditions.
